Board approves Benjamin Center RFP after brief debate over using the word “senior”

Village Board of Shorewood · February 17, 2026

Summary

The Village Board approved an RFP for the Benjamin Center's architectural design and construction administration. Trustee Stokbrand asked whether the word “senior” should appear in the facility name; village staff said the Senior Resource Center will retain its name while the broader facility will be called the Benjamin Center.

The Shorewood Village Board approved a request for proposals (RFP) for architectural design, construction document services and construction administration for the Benjamin Center.
